Weather in February

Sea temperature

With an average sea temperature of 10.9°C (51.6°F), February is the month with the coldest seawater in Punat, Croatia.
Note: Beware of 10.9°C (51.6°F) waters at 13°C (55.4°F), they're uninviting, and a dip below 10°C (50°F) has risks of breath loss and cold shock, contingent on health.

Daylight

In February, the average length of the day is 10h and 26min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 07:21 and sunset at 17:08. On the last day of February, in Punat, sunrise is at 06:40 and sunset at 17:47 CET.
